Church service confession: Indiana pastor quits amid sex scandal

Kosciusko prosecutor investigating allegations involving teenager

WARSAW, Ind. (WANE) – A Warsaw church pastor admitted to his congregation on Sunday what he said was an adulterous relationship. Then his apparent victim came forward and said she was 16 at the time.

After the tumultuous revelations at New Life Christian Church, Pastor John Lowe II resigned and the Kosciusko County District Attorney’s Office confirmed it was investigating the allegations.

Video (look above) of the admission was widely shared on Facebook by a participant. By mid-afternoon on Monday, it had over 90,000 views.

In the video, Lowe confessed, “I committed adultery” with “a person” nearly 20 years ago, and continued the relationship “for far too long.”

“I have no defense,” he told the congregation. “I committed adultery. To put it plainly: I didn’t make a mistake, I didn’t have a problem, I didn’t have an affair, I didn’t make an error in judgment – ​​I Fishing. I need to say it, and you deserve to hear it.

Lowe asked the congregation to forgive him for the “deep hurt” he caused and apologized to those against whom he had sinned. He said there was “no right answer” to why it took so long to admit his wrongdoing, but said he had repented.

Lowe then announced that he was leaving the ministry and said he would submit to the process and recommendation of the church board.

After they finished speaking, a man and a woman approached the lectern. The woman told the congregation she was a victim of Lowe’s when she was 16 and said she had lived in “a prison” for 27 years – not 20.

“You did things to my teenage body that never had and never should have been done,” she said. “If you cannot admit the truth, you must answer for it before God. You are not the victim here.

She continued, “The church deserves to know the truth. This church was built on lies, but no more. The lies must stop.

The woman said she spent years feeling like a ‘horrible person’ with suicidal thoughts until two weeks ago when her brother approached her about a memory of seeing his younger sister in bed with her pastor.

“The lies and manipulation must stop,” she said.

After the woman left the stage, members of the congregation shouted at Lowe.

“If you did, you have to admit it,” one man shouted.

“We need to hear from our pastor,” said another.

Lowe replied, “I told you I had committed adultery and I told you it had gone on far too long.”

“I can’t do anything about it except tell you if I could go back and do it all over again, I would.” I can’t, and all I can do is ask you to forgive me.

The Kosciusko County District Attorney’s Office confirmed to WANE 15 on Monday that an investigation is ongoing into the matter. However, no other information was provided.

From Monday, the New Life Facebook Page had been closed.

Lowe remains listed as the church’s senior pastor on his website.
